Understanding the Power of ERP for Small Manufacturers

An ERP system is a software suite designed to manage a company’s resources and streamline operations across various departments. In the context of small manufacturing, this typically includes modules for inventory management, production planning, materials management, sales and customer relationship management (CRM), accounting, and even quality control. Unlike disparate systems that require manual data entry and reconciliation, an ERP provides a single source of truth, fostering collaboration and informed decision-making.

Key Benefits of Implementing an ERP System

Implementing an ERP system can offer a multitude of benefits for small manufacturing companies, driving efficiency, reducing costs, and ultimately, fostering growth. Here are some of the most significant advantages:

  • Improved Inventory Management: Managing inventory effectively is crucial for profitability. An ERP system provides real-time visibility into inventory levels, allowing manufacturers to optimize stock levels, minimize waste, and avoid stockouts or overstocking. This is particularly valuable for small manufacturers with limited storage space and tight budgets. With features like automated reorder points and demand forecasting, manufacturers can ensure they have the right materials on hand, at the right time.

  • Streamlined Production Planning: Effective production planning is essential for meeting customer demand and minimizing lead times. An ERP system enables manufacturers to create accurate production schedules based on real-time data, considering factors like raw material availability, machine capacity, and labor constraints. This helps optimize production flow, reduce bottlenecks, and improve overall efficiency.

  • Enhanced Materials Management: From sourcing raw materials to managing vendor relationships, materials management is a complex process. An ERP system streamlines this process by providing tools for managing purchase orders, tracking shipments, and monitoring supplier performance. This can lead to cost savings through better negotiation, improved supplier relationships, and reduced material waste.

  • Integrated Sales and CRM: Connecting sales and CRM functionalities within the ERP system allows for a seamless flow of information between departments. Sales teams can access real-time inventory data, providing accurate lead times to customers. Customer order information is automatically integrated into the production schedule, ensuring that orders are fulfilled efficiently. This integration improves customer satisfaction and strengthens customer relationships.

  • Improved Accounting and Financial Reporting: A centralized accounting module within the ERP system automates financial processes, such as invoicing, accounts payable, and accounts receivable. This reduces manual errors, improves data accuracy, and provides real-time financial insights. Accurate financial reporting allows manufacturers to track profitability, manage cash flow, and make informed financial decisions.

  • Enhanced Quality Control: Modern ERP systems often include modules for quality control, allowing manufacturers to track and manage quality issues throughout the production process. This helps identify areas for improvement, reduce defects, and ensure that products meet customer expectations. Features like automated quality checks and non-conformance reporting can significantly improve product quality and reduce the risk of recalls.

  • Data-Driven Decision Making: With all business data centralized in one system, manufacturers can gain valuable insights into their operations. ERP systems provide reporting and analytics tools that allow users to track key performance indicators (KPIs), identify trends, and make data-driven decisions. This empowers manufacturers to optimize their processes, improve efficiency, and drive growth.

Choosing the Right ERP System for Your Needs

Selecting the right ERP system is a critical decision that requires careful consideration. Not all ERP systems are created equal, and it’s important to choose a system that aligns with the specific needs and requirements of your small manufacturing business.

Key Considerations for ERP Selection

  • Business Requirements: Start by identifying your specific business requirements. What are your pain points? What processes do you want to improve? What are your growth objectives? Create a detailed list of requirements that will serve as a guide during the selection process.

  • Scalability: Choose an ERP system that can scale with your business. As your company grows, your ERP system needs to be able to accommodate increasing data volumes and new functionalities. Consider a cloud-based ERP system, which offers greater scalability and flexibility compared to on-premise solutions.

  • Industry-Specific Functionality: Look for an ERP system that is specifically designed for the manufacturing industry. These systems typically include features that are tailored to the unique needs of manufacturers, such as bill of materials (BOM) management, work order management, and shop floor control.

  • Ease of Use: The ERP system should be user-friendly and easy to learn. Complex systems with steep learning curves can lead to frustration and resistance from employees. Choose a system with an intuitive interface and comprehensive training resources.

  • Integration Capabilities: Ensure that the ERP system can integrate with your existing systems, such as your CRM, e-commerce platform, and CAD software. Seamless integration is essential for ensuring data consistency and avoiding data silos.

  • Vendor Support: Choose a reputable vendor with a proven track record of providing excellent customer support. You’ll need ongoing support and training as you implement and use the ERP system.

  • Cost: Cost is always a factor to consider, but don’t let it be the sole deciding factor. Focus on the long-term value of the ERP system and the potential return on investment. Consider the total cost of ownership, including software licenses, implementation costs, training costs, and ongoing maintenance costs.

Types of ERP Systems for Small Manufacturing

  • Cloud-Based ERP: These systems are hosted in the cloud and accessed via the internet. They offer greater flexibility, scalability, and affordability compared to on-premise solutions.
  • On-Premise ERP: These systems are installed on your own servers and managed by your IT staff. They offer greater control over your data, but they can be more expensive to implement and maintain.
  • Hybrid ERP: A combination of cloud-based and on-premise ERP, allowing businesses to leverage the benefits of both deployment models.

The Future of ERP in Small Manufacturing

The future of ERP in small manufacturing is characterized by increasing automation, artificial intelligence (AI), and the Internet of Things (IoT). These technologies are transforming the way manufacturers operate, enabling them to become more efficient, agile, and responsive to customer needs.

Emerging Trends in ERP

  • AI-Powered ERP: AI is being integrated into ERP systems to automate tasks, improve decision-making, and personalize user experiences.
  • IoT Integration: Connecting machines and equipment to the ERP system via IoT sensors provides real-time data on machine performance, enabling predictive maintenance and improved production efficiency.
  • Mobile ERP: Mobile ERP solutions allow users to access ERP data and perform tasks from anywhere, improving collaboration and responsiveness.
